On my '23 OBX, I bought the factory bumper protector. It was easy to install, looks great, and has held up very well. For the door jambs I went a different route. I did not like the factory ones and felt they were very expensive. Instead, I bought a 12' roll of 2" wide safe way traction tape on Amazon. You can cut it to any length, apply, and forget it. I had enough to do both of my vehicles.
